

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
融合Python技术与BSM期权定价模型的交易数据分析 融合Python技术与BSM期权定价模型的交易数据分析 摘要: 随着金融市场的不断发展和变化,交易数据分析在金融领域中的应用变得越来越重要。本文旨在探讨如何使用Python技术结合Black-Scholes-Merton(BSM)期权定价模型来进行交易数据分析。通过使用Python编程语言来处理和分析交易数据,可以更好地理解和评估金融市场中的交易。同时,BSM模型可以帮助我们更准确地估计期权定价。 1、引言 随着金融市场的日益发展,交易数据的积累和管理变得越来越重要。对于投资者和交易员来说,准确地分析和解读交易数据可以帮助他们作出更明智的决策。在金融市场中,期权定价模型是一种常用的工具,它可以帮助投资者估计期权的价值。Black-Scholes-Merton(BSM)模型是其中最著名的一种。 2、Python技术在交易数据分析中的应用 Python是一种功能强大的编程语言,可以通过使用其各种库和模块来进行数据处理和分析。在金融市场中使用Python来处理交易数据可以极大地提高效率和准确性。Python的优势之一是它可以轻松地处理大量数据,并且提供了各种统计工具和绘图功能,以帮助我们更好地理解数据。 3、BSM期权定价模型的基本原理 BSM模型最初由Black、Scholes和Merton在1973年提出,被广泛应用于期权定价。它的基本原理是基于假设:股票价格遵循几何布朗运动,市场是有效的,且没有交易费用和股息。通过这些假设,我们可以根据股票价格,期权行权价,剩余时间,无风险利率和波动率等参数计算出期权的理论价格。 4、Python实现BSM模型 通过使用Python,我们可以很容易地实现BSM模型。首先,我们需要使用Python的数值计算库(如numpy)来计算标准正态分布函数和逆函数。然后,我们可以使用Python的科学计算库(如scipy)来计算期权的理论价格。最后,我们可以使用Python的数据可视化库(如matplotlib)来绘制期权的理论价格曲线。 5、交易数据分析实例 以股票期权为例,我们可以使用Python来分析交易数据。首先,我们可以使用Python获取股票的历史价格数据,并使用移动平均等方法来进行技术分析。然后,我们可以使用BSM模型来估计期权的理论价格,并与实际价格进行对比。最后,我们可以使用Python的数据可视化功能来绘制股票价格和期权价格的变化曲线。 6、结论 通过结合Python技术和BSM期权定价模型,我们可以更好地理解和分析金融市场中的交易数据。Python的强大功能和丰富的库和模块使得处理和分析交易数据变得更加高效和准确。同时,BSM模型可以帮助我们更准确地估计期权的价值。因此,使用Python技术结合BSM模型进行交易数据分析是一种值得推广和应用的方法。 参考文献: [1]Hull,J.C.(2015).Options,Futures,andOtherDerivatives.Pearson. [2]张文丽.金融数学模型与应用[M].高等教育出版社,2017. [3]James,C(2009)PythonforFinance.O'ReillyMedia. 关键词:交易数据分析,Python技术,BSM期权定价模型,金融市场

快乐****蜜蜂
实名认证
内容提供者


最近下载